    Road work
    Run 3-5 miles daily
    Jump rope for 20 minutes a day (straight)
    Add sprints at the end of workout
    Strength Training
    EMOM
    Pushups - 5 sets
    Pullups - 5 sets
    Squats - 5 sets
    Abs/leg raises - 5 sets
    Dips - 5 sets
    Neck - 5 sets
    Shoulder - sets
    2-3 times daily

    I really enyojed this video,but there is just one thing that I think you overlooked,and that is shoulder muscles;
    When talking about EMOM you just said to do some shoulder exercise instead of actually going deeper into that and giving tips on shoulder training,I think shoulder muscles are really important in boxing,that's one of the reasons why your shoulders get heavy,so I train them pretty hard
    That shadowboxing workout is good,but I think there should be more to it
    (I know push ups activate front shoulder muscles but I don't think it's enough for you to get strong shoulders)
    Other than that, amazing video,keep it up,I'm waiting for the next one to drop, whatever it is :D

    • @BrawlBrosBoxing
      @BrawlBrosBoxing  2 роки тому +2

      Great feedback! Here is what I'll say on shoulders:
      Dips, pull-ups and pushups, in combination with the shadowboxing and may weather drill in this video will do a ton for your shoulders. But while that help, targeting is still good. What I didn't mention (only showed a clip of) is that I do alternating shoulder raises with a kettlebell, each set to failure for up tp 5 sets.
      Thanks for pointing that out! Leaving this comment for anyone else who may have that question.
